I wanted to play AVI files on my MS Media Player and i was told that i would need a Codec for the player. The player is updated to the newest version. I was hopeing that someone on here could 1. Tell me where to get this and 2. Where and how to install it. I have tried to install it before, but the install must not have worked correctly because i still can not veiw AVI files on the player. ALSO, i was wondering what was needed to play AVI files through Winamp. I have the newest version for Winamp also, but some AVI files will play and others will not, its kinda wierd =/. Any help would be appreciated.
 
Normal AVI files you would not need a codec.. however, if this file has been encoded using something like DivX or Xvid, then you would need those respective codecs.
